The Mechanics Behind Virtual Roulette
Understanding how digital roulette operates begins with the core principles of the game. At its essence, roulette involves a spinning wheel, a ball, and a betting layout. When players place chips on specific numbers, colors, or groups, they are wagering on where the ball will land once the wheel spins. In online versions, the game employs Random Number Generators (RNGs) to simulate this process with high precision. Certified RNGs, such as those tested by eCOGRA or GLI, ensure fairness by producing outcomes that are independent and unpredictable.
The payout structure of online roulette varies depending on the type of bet. A straight-up number bet typically offers a 35 to 1 payout, while a red or black or odd/even bet usually pays 1 to 1. Many virtual tables follow the same payout sequences as their land-based counterparts, with some variations introduced by specific game rules or proprietary features. The game’s interface often displays a virtual wheel and betting grid, conformed to standard roulette layouts, for an authentic experience.
The Role of RNG and Fairness in Free Play
Digital roulette games are powered by RNG technology, which has to meet strict industry standards to gain licensing approval. Operators licensed under jurisdictions such as the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) or the UK Gambling Commission are required to have their RNG software tested regularly. Independent testing labs like iTech Labs verify that the outcomes are truly random, preventing the possibility of manipulation or bias.
Because free versions rely solely on RNGs, players can assess game fairness before wagering real money. Many providers publish their paytable and return-to-player (RTP) percentages publicly. Generally, European roulette games, with a single zero, tend to offer an RTP of around 97.3%, while American variants, with a double zero, have slightly lower, approximately 94.7%. These figures are crucial when considering the long-term profitability of various betting strategies.

Types of Virtual Roulette Games Available Online
Online casinos typically offer a variety of roulette variants, many of which are playable for free. Each version caters to different preferences in terms of rules, betting options, and visual design.
European Roulette
This is the most prevalent variant, featuring a single zero pocket. Its RTP of approximately 97.3% makes it more favorable to players than other versions. Most free demos adhere to European rules, with the wheel divided into numbered pockets from 0 to 36, and the betting layout matching a traditional European table.
American Roulette
Characterized by an additional double zero pocket, this version introduces an RTP of roughly 94.7%. The extra zero increases the house edge, making it less advantageous over time but adding a different gameplay dynamic. Many online platforms provide free American roulette games to allow users to compare strategies across variants.
French Roulette
Similar to European roulette, French versions often incorporate unique rules such as “La Partage” or “En Prison,” which can reduce the house edge further. Free French roulette games are popular among players seeking to maximize their odds, with the game interface often labeled in French or bilingual.

Strategies and Their Efficacy in Free Play
Many beginners and even experienced players employ betting strategies to improve their chances or manage their bankroll more effectively. In free versions, testing these tactics allows for an understanding of their strengths and limitations.
Martingale System
This involves doubling the bet after each loss, aiming to recover previous losses with a subsequent win. While easy to implement in demo mode, it’s limited by table maximums and virtual bankrolls. Most licensed operators set bet limits on their tables, often around €500 or equivalent.
Fibonacci Sequence
This system uses a mathematical sequence to determine bet size. Its conservative approach makes it more sustainable in the short term, but it does not alter the overall house edge, which remains around 2.7% for European roulette. Free play enables players to see firsthand how this system performs over extended sessions.
D’Alembert Strategy
This involves increasing or decreasing bets by one unit based on the previous outcome. It’s popular in free mode for its simplicity but offers no guaranteed advantage. Testing it in demo environments helps users understand variance and risk.
Outside Bet Focus
Focusing on red/black, odd/even, or high/low bets gives a lower payout but higher probability of winning. Free play allows players to explore the stability of these bets and how betting frequency affects their virtual bankroll.

Licensing, Certification, and Industry Standards
Reputable providers hosting free roulette games operate under licenses from authorities like the MGA or the UK Gambling Commission. These licenses mandate adherence to strict standards for fairness, security, and responsible gaming. Games undergo regular testing by independent laboratories such as eCOGRA, GLI, or iTech Labs, which certify that outcomes are random and payout percentages meet published expectations.
The software’s RNG must pass rigorous testing before deployment. Game developers also publish return-to-player percentages, typically ranging from 94% to 98%, depending on the variant and rules in play. These numbers serve as a benchmark for players assessing the fairness of the virtual environment.
